Compare all specifications:
1948 Alfa Romeo 6C | 1990 Renault Alpine |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Renault |
Model | 6C | Alpine |
Year Released | 1948 | 1990 |
Engine Position | Front | Rear |
Engine Size | 2442 cc | 2458 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 89 HP | 182 HP |
Engine RPM | 4600 RPM | 5750 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 72 mm | 91.1 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 100 mm | 63 mm |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1500 kg | 1210 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4880 mm | 4340 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1840 mm | 1760 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1510 mm | 1200 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3010 mm | 2350 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 77 L | 72 L |
